Aller au contenu

Commandes utiles pour K8S

Pour K8S, les commandes sont assez difficiles de base. De plus, il existe certaines commandes assez tricky que je vais essayer de répertorier ici

$ kubectl delete pods --field-selector=status.phase!=Running -A

Permet de supprimer les pods de la liste qui ne sont pas running (Dont les evicted)

$ kubectl get Issuers,ClusterIssuers,Certificates,CertificateRequests,Orders,Challenges -A

Liste toutes les ressources qui sont link à la génération d'un certificat

$ kubectl get pods -o name | xargs -I{} kubectl exec {} -- <command goes here>

Permet d'exécuter la même commande sur de multiples pods


Dernière mise à jour: November 27, 2023
Créé: November 27, 2023